Installation Notes

Remove the old manifold carefully—those studs love to snap off after years of heat cycling. Clean all mating surfaces thoroughly and check for cracks in the head before installing. Always use new gaskets and studs—don’t try to reuse the old hardware. If you’ve got a broken stud in the head, address it properly with extraction tools before installing the replacement. A little anti-seize compound on the threads makes future service much easier.
